Definição
To talk loudly and proudly about something, often to show off or draw attention. It can also mean making something seem very important or exciting.

Ouça em Contexto
He likes to shout about his good grades.
There's nothing to shout about in this report.
She doesn't like to shout about her success.
It's not the kind of news you want to shout about to everyone.
